THE COMPREHENSIVE GUIDE TO INTERNET SOLUTIONS: A DETAILED INTRODUCTION

The Comprehensive Guide To Internet Solutions: A Detailed Introduction

The Comprehensive Guide To Internet Solutions: A Detailed Introduction

Blog Article

Material By-Schou Fulton

Discover the utmost Internet Solutions Handbook for all your demands. top website development company , core concepts of SOAP and remainder, and finest methods for smooth application. Reveal the keys to understanding web solutions, from understanding the basics to executing scalable design. Master the art of making protected systems and enhancing for future growth. Unlock the power of internet solutions within your reaches.

Introduction of Internet Services



If you have actually ever before questioned what web services are and just how they work, this summary is the ideal place to start. https://best-email-marketing-soft74051.blogginaway.com/27068622/interested-in-discovering-exactly-how-web-site-layout-has-changed-throughout-the-years-explore-the-journey are a means for various applications to communicate with each other online. They permit seamless assimilation of systems, making it simpler to share data and capabilities.

Among the vital aspects of internet services is their use basic procedures like HTTP and XML to facilitate interaction. This standardization makes certain that different systems can comprehend and communicate with each other effectively. Internet services can be classified right into 2 major types: SOAP (Simple Item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a procedure that makes use of XML for message exchange, while remainder relies on common HTTP methods like GET, POST, PUT, and DELETE. Both have their toughness and are made use of in different circumstances based on requirements.

Key Principles and Technologies



Checking out the foundational principles and innovations of internet solutions is essential for comprehending their functionality and application in modern systems. When delving right into the vital concepts and technologies of web solutions, you open the door to a globe of interconnected possibilities. Here are some essential elements to realize:

- ** SOAP (Simple Object Gain Access To Procedure) **: This procedure specifies the structure of messages traded in between internet sol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is utilized to describe the performances supplied by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that utilizes basic HTTP methods for interaction between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in information exchange in between web services as a result of its convenience and readability.

Recognizing these core concepts and modern technologies will lay a strong foundation for your journey into the world of internet solutions.

Best Practices for Implementation



To ensure successful implementation of internet solutions, focus on adherence to best practices. Begin by completely recording your web solution APIs, consisting of clear summaries of endpoints, specifications, and expected responses. Constant calling conventions and versioning of APIs are crucial for maintainability. When developing your internet services, adhere to the concepts of REST to create a scalable and flexible architecture. Apply appropriate authentication and authorization systems to secure your services, such as OAuth or API keys.

Examining is crucial in ensuring the integrity of your web solutions. Establish comprehensive test cases that cover numerous situations, including positive and negative testing. Continuous assimilation and automated testing can assist catch concerns early in the advancement procedure. Screen https://what-is-digital-marketing33210.slypage.com/27106448/fine-tune-your-web-site-s-prospective-with-tried-and-tested-strategies-for-crafting-efficient-call-to-actions in real-time to identify performance bottlenecks and prospective failures. Logging and mistake handling are important for diagnosing problems and troubleshooting troubles successfully.



Finally, consider the scalability of your web solutions deliberately for future growth. Apply caching systems and load balancing to deal with enhanced web traffic. Consistently testimonial and maximize your code for performance. By following these ideal practices, you can improve the implementation of web solutions and ensure their success.

Conclusion

Congratulations! You have actually just unlocked the trick to understanding internet services. By understanding the essential concepts and innovations, and applying best methods, you're well on your way to ending up being a web solutions professional.

Maintain discovering and explore what you've found out to continue increasing your knowledge and abilities in this exciting field.

The globe of web solutions is now within your reaches, prepared for you to check out and conquer. Enjoy the journey!